摘要
The present study was aimed at the identification of biological components from pathogenic-infected Astragalus adsurgens with an activity-guided purification process. Fifteen flavonoids were obtained from the most active ethyl acetate fraction and identified as astradsurnin (1), a new chalcone derivative, together with fourteen known flavonoids (2-15). These compounds were tested for antibacterial activities against five bacteria and cytotoxic activities against two selected cancer cells. Within the series of flavonoids tested, compounds 4 and 15 were the most active against Escherichia coli, Bacillus cereus, Staphylococcus aureus, Erwinia carotovora and Bacillus subtilis with MICs ranging from 7.8 to 31.3 mu g/ml. Moreover, compounds 4 and 5 exhibited moderate activity against HL-60 and SMMC-7721 cells with IC50 values between 5 and 10 mu g/ml. To our knowledge, this is the first time that it has been reported on the biological and chemical study of A. adsurgens infected by Embellisia astragali.
